CWE-843
AllowedAccess of Resource Using Incompatible Type ('Type Confusion')
Abstraction: Base · Status: Incomplete
The product allocates or initializes a resource such as a pointer, object, or variable using one type, but it later accesses that resource using a type that is incompatible with the original type.

GHSA-8XF4-W7QW-PJJW
Vulnerability from github – Published: 2022-03-30 00:00 – Updated: 2023-02-17 14:26In Firebase PHP-JWT before 6.0.0, an algorithm-confusion issue (e.g., RS256 / HS256) exists via the kid (aka Key ID) header, when multiple types of keys are loaded in a key ring. This allows an attacker to forge tokens that validate under the incorrect key. NOTE: this provides a straightforward way to use the PHP-JWT library unsafely, but might not be considered a vulnerability in the library itself.

Vulnerability from github – Published: 2026-06-19 14:38 – Updated: 2026-06-19 14:38Summary
CedarJava is an open source Java implementation of the Cedar policy language, used for fine-grained authorization decisions. Under certain circumstances, improper input handling could allow type confusion across the Java-Rust FFI boundary.
Impact
Record-to-Entity type confusion across the Java-Rust FFI boundary
CedarJava sends authorization requests to the Rust cedar-policy evaluator as JSON. The JSON protocol reserves magic single-key object shapes (__entity and __extn) for entity references and extension values. When serializing a CedarMap, there is no validation preventing these reserved keys from being used. If an integrating service builds a CedarMap from caller-supplied key/value data (such as request headers, user-defined metadata, or resource tags), an actor who controls those keys could cause the Rust evaluator to interpret a record as an entity reference.
This issue requires the integrating service to build a CedarMap where the an actor controls the keys, and a policy must reference that value in a when/unless clause.
Impacted versions:
< 4.9
Patches
Addressed in CedarJava version 2.3.6, 3.4.1, and 4.9 and above. We recommend upgrading to the latest version and ensuring any forked or derivative code is patched to incorporate the new fixes.
Workarounds
Enable schema-based request validation to catch type mismatches. Validate that user-controlled data does not contain reserved keys (__entity or __extn) before building CedarMap objects.
